    Email duplicated ?
    Well, not really a novice but almost...

    Very confusing situation... an hour ago I had 14 unread emails, when I came back now, I had 462 unread emails. For some reason almost all my emails in my inbox were duplicated, the unread and the read emails. I checked them all and even the 14 unread were also doubled? But every single one was not copied, only about 90% and for only the last couple weeks. Before that they were not copied.

    I just had Outlook 2007 installed on my new computer about three and a half weeks ago, this is the first time that this has happened since then. My other computer crashed and a computer guy from "Friendly Computers" was able to save everything; contacts, old emails, programs, games, etc and transfer them to this computer. The old Outlook was deleted and that is when Outlook 2007 was installed.

    Now what is strange is, about two weeks before my old computer crashed I had the same problem, it started to duplicate my emails in the same manner.

    When the emails arrive they do not arrive as duplicates, it seems to just happen all at once like tonight.

    Another thing, I have 93% free space now and I am getting a pop up window that told me that there is not enough space to run "spell check?" When I rebooted it was then OK?

    Any help would be very appreciated.

    Check you Online Email (Most, if not all ISP offer a webmail service so you can check when not at home)

    Don't use Outlook for a few days.. so what happens.

    - also, for fun, go into the properties for your email account
    - look for the advanced section. Make sure the "Leave copy on server" is NOT checked.


    And get Malwarebytes.org run it.. see if comes up with anything

    In your Accounts

    Tools > E-mail Accounts > View or Change...
    Select the acct > CLick change
    Click More Settings > I think its in there..?
